The global HSBC Infrastructure Finance (“HIF”) team comprised of Infrastructure Finance and Export Finance provides a full suite of financing solutions to corporates, financial sponsors, financial institutions and governments in a variety of sectors, including Infrastructure, Shipping, Transport, Logistics, Renewables and Power & Utilities.

The team provides a central point for clients to access product agnostic advice on financing, capital structure and structured debt capital markets, as well as origination and execution of infrastructure, project and export finance lending mandates. HIF plays a critical role in financing the energy transition for our clients and we have pivoted our business model, aiming to increase our provision of financing to key energy transition sub-sectors, to monetise the transition and deliver incremental revenue for the bank. HIF consists of over 175 employees located in 14 countries with key hubs in London, Paris, Dubai, Hong Kong, Singapore and New York.

The Export Finance team supports the cross-border trade of capital goods and services by HSBC’s clients using government support programs. These programs are administered by Export Credit Agencies (ECAs), to credit enhance the financing provided to the borrowers. The business is one of the world’s leading arrangers of ECA supported debt with a long-established track-record. 

The Export Finance team works across product, region, country and sectors to arrange medium and long-term financing for clients in the public and private sectors purchasing capital goods and services or investing in a particular region. Export Finance can cover inter alia infrastructure development, manufacturing equipment, marine assets, aircraft, power generation equipment, real estate and a host of other goods and services.
